diff options
Diffstat (limited to 'community/baculum/APKBUILD')
-rw-r--r-- | community/baculum/APKBUILD | 25 |
1 files changed, 14 insertions, 11 deletions
diff --git a/community/baculum/APKBUILD b/community/baculum/APKBUILD index 7238f2fbfa0..853aa0eed3a 100644 --- a/community/baculum/APKBUILD +++ b/community/baculum/APKBUILD @@ -1,13 +1,12 @@ # Maintainer: Natanael Copa <ncopa@alpinelinux.org> pkgname=baculum -pkgver=9.6.7 -pkgrel=0 +pkgver=13.0.3 +pkgrel=1 pkgdesc="API layer to Baculum WebGUI tool for Bacula Community program" url="https://bacula.org/" arch="noarch" -license="AGPLv3" -depends="" -_php=php7 +license="AGPL-3.0-or-later" +_php=php82 _common_depends=" $_php-common $_php-ctype @@ -37,7 +36,6 @@ makedepends=" $_web_depends " pkggroups="www-data" -install="" subpackages="$pkgname-common:_common $pkgname-api:_api $pkgname-web:_web @@ -47,9 +45,9 @@ subpackages="$pkgname-common:_common $pkgname-web-lighttpd:_web_lighttpd " source="https://downloads.sourceforge.net/project/bacula/bacula/$pkgver/bacula-gui-$pkgver.tar.gz - fix-missing-common-pages.patch fix-locale-symlinks.patch shared-config-dir.patch + fix-php8.patch " builddir="$srcdir/"bacula-gui-$pkgver/baculum @@ -72,6 +70,9 @@ package() { chgrp -R www-data "$pkgdir"/etc/baculum/Config-* chmod g+w "$pkgdir"/etc/baculum/Config-* chmod g+rw "$pkgdir"/etc/baculum/Config-*/baculum.users + + rm -rf "$pkgdir"/usr/lib/systemd + rm "$pkgdir"/baculum-install-checker.sh } _common() { @@ -79,7 +80,7 @@ _common() { depends="$_common_depends" amove usr/share/baculum/htdocs/protected/Common \ usr/share/baculum/htdocs/protected/application.xml \ - usr/share/baculum/htdocs/framework \ + usr/share/baculum/htdocs/protected/autoload.php \ usr/share/baculum/htdocs/themes \ usr/share/baculum/htdocs/LICENSE \ usr/share/baculum/htdocs/AUTHORS \ @@ -151,7 +152,9 @@ _web_lighttpd() { amove etc/lighttpd/baculum-web.conf } -sha512sums="de48a7087b99bd57a81fb24d42ffa70f4c6923fab7c801f7f58544557812859c9e35b62f8ee9b9d17de24ae92aa8d77a4499e7943cffc8be334c4c13887ef432 bacula-gui-9.6.7.tar.gz -6c87cd9c4e2946077b9f0204cccf231b1e4f70620b18590511a84859b391acbc20ee8471c6d7b1c0e62b1b64ee2d77e39aee600b3ea474131cc39510e830155b fix-missing-common-pages.patch +sha512sums=" +886bb2b9b0bfb9ed665ef12523eac13385111ae776726f40da47726bc4fee88391daffba8385591b82455af1b1fbbeec879b2c82b625da666b07abe9880d3f53 bacula-gui-13.0.3.tar.gz 88e2d8311a96f55a327b54a267dc1a694107d09f49640f6eb484e6e67ce9985750cfce20fa16755d2db82230d966001304fe033479d484f985af7aaa921a8915 fix-locale-symlinks.patch -7b3f008e16151657aae57f4573b04f45fb2d791b90efce51ac74318f539240f73a4c8589d98f820b82bd11f5c4b3deeea052a3b33d7769357d63578096a1e0ae shared-config-dir.patch" +7b3f008e16151657aae57f4573b04f45fb2d791b90efce51ac74318f539240f73a4c8589d98f820b82bd11f5c4b3deeea052a3b33d7769357d63578096a1e0ae shared-config-dir.patch +c1cd5ea52049b1cf621dfa481af59bca103368b3bb69754e8ec62b9a64de0b7785ca80bf6f9fe1ff549bf9cc7e03e4a7dc99153b75578fa05c0a4480d20cac7e fix-php8.patch +" |